Oxygen Infusion Fluid Dynamics, Pressure Amplification & Spray Efficiency

A water-saving shower head must optimize flow velocity, droplet expansion, and pressure utilization.

How does oxygen infusion enhance spray performance at low flow rates?
Air mixing increases droplet volume while maintaining velocity, improving perceived pressure.
What internal design converts pressure into higher velocity output?
Pressurized chambers accelerate flow before discharge through nozzles.
How is clogging minimized in micro-nozzle systems?
Scale-resistant materials reduce mineral accumulation inside flow channels.
Does aeration alter the Reynolds number of the flow?
Air-water mixture changes flow characteristics, increasing turbulence while maintaining efficiency.
